1. What Is Teacher Contact Data?
Teacher
contact data refers to the information that enables
communication with teachers. It includes their names, email
addresses, phone numbers, and sometimes additional details such
as school affiliation or subject specialization. This data
allows students, parents, administrators, or other relevant
parties to get in touch with teachers for various purposes.
2. How Is Teacher Contact Data Collected?
Teacher contact data is typically collected through school
registration systems, teacher profiles, or administrative
records. Schools may require teachers to provide their contact
information during the hiring process or as part of ongoing
administrative procedures. In some cases, teachers may also
voluntarily share their contact information with students or
parents for improved communication.
3. What Types of Data Are Included in Teacher Contact
Data?
Teacher contact data typically includes the teacher's full
name, email address, phone number, and sometimes additional
information such as the school name or department. It may also
include alternative contact methods, such as social media
profiles or communication platforms used by the teachers for
professional purposes.
4. How Can Teacher Contact Data Be Used?
Teacher contact data is primarily used for facilitating
communication between teachers, students, parents, and school
administrators. It allows for direct contact with teachers for
inquiries, scheduling appointments, sharing important
information, or addressing any concerns related to the
educational process. Additionally, teacher contact data can be
used for administrative purposes, such as distributing
school-wide announcements or coordinating professional
development activities.
